
West Brom: Arsenal star William Saliba sends Yann M’Vila one-word message after Watford draw
Arsenal defender William Saliba has sent West Brom midfielder Yann M’Vila a one-word message following the Baggies’ comeback draw against Watford.
M’Vila joined West Brom as a free agent in February and made his second appearance for his new club against the Hornets, coming off the bench to help Carlos Corberan’s men fight back from 2-0 down to draw 2-2.
And Saliba praised his fellow Frenchman with a one-word post on social media that simply read: “Maestro”.
Yann M’Vila showing flashes of his undeniable ability
Yann M’Vila’s career is perhaps curiously most defined by the transfer he never made – despite persistent links with Arsenal, the midfielder never joined the Premier League giants.
However, his journeyman CV includes spells at Rennes, Saint-Etienne, Olympiacos, Rubin Kazan, Sunderland – and even a brief loan at Inter.
The 33-year-old boasts a wealth of experience and has demonstrated his undeniable quality in flashes across his two substitute appearances for the Baggies.

He was part of a midfield triple-substitution after Watford’s second goal and deserves his share of the credit for the team’s spirited fightback – even if Grady Diangana’s pair of assists rightly stole the headlines.
If M’Vila can become a consistent performer for West Brom, he has the potential to raise the Baggies’ level as they hunt down a return to the Premier League.
